I'm the Director of Research at Sunbird AI in Uganda. Previously I was a Staff Research Software Engineer at Google Research, and tech lead for Africa projects at UN Global Pulse.
Some projects:
- Sunflower is a collection of LLMs that support 31 Ugandan languages, optimised for machine translation. At the time of writing, these models are the state of the art on translation accuracy for 24 of those languages.
[preprint, models, blog] - I started the Open Buildings project in Google Brain, using computer vision and satellite imagery to map nearly all the buildings in Africa, Latin America and South/Southeast Asia. We added around a billion buildings to Google Maps, and open-sourced a dataset widely used for census planning, disaster response, vaccination campaigns and other practical applications.
- At the UN I worked on language technology for early warning from community radio stations.
- I co-founded the AI lab at Makerere University and worked on various practical projects including malaria diagnosis and crop disease classification.
